Abstract
Embodiments of the disclosure provide for a knowledge search engine platform to identifying first data associated with a merchant system from one or more databases based on a search query submitted by a user device. The knowledge search engine platform generates a user dialog interface to display to the user device to enable a communication to collect additional information to supplement the first data. Second data to supplement the first data is received from the user system via the user dialog interface. Responsive to receiving the second data, a set of communications are transmitted to a set of search provider systems, where each communication of the set of communications comprising a recommended update comprising the first data and the second data.
